CVE-2026-42764: Azure QUIC NULL Pointer DoS Flaw

🟠 High | Source: Microsoft Security Response Center CVE-2026-42764 is a NULL pointer dereference vulnerability in the QUIC protocol server’s handling of initial packets on Microsoft Azure. This type of flaw can typically be exploited by an unauthenticated remote attacker to crash the affected service, potentially causing a denial of service. It matters because QUIC is increasingly used for high-performance, low-latency connections, meaning internet-facing services relying on it could be disrupted without authentication. ...
